- farhan muhharamNov 22, 2023 · 2 years agoOne of the best ways to safely store your digital assets is by using a hardware wallet. Hardware wallets are physical devices that store your private keys offline, making it extremely difficult for hackers to access your assets. These wallets are designed with advanced security features and encryption protocols to ensure the safety of your assets. Some popular hardware wallets include Ledger and Trezor. Remember to keep your hardware wallet in a safe place and backup your recovery phrase in case of loss or damage.
